The Great Wall between artist and fan has been graffed on, urinated on, and ultimately knocked the hell down thanks to the internet. Artists see the internet as an antiseptic means of communicating with their fans on their own terms -- i.e. without having to face them. Unfortunately, the meeting of the fragile egos of both artist and message board poster alike does not always yield productive results. On the contrary, it usually gets mad ugly. The demands of webfanatics inevitably prove to be too great for the artist, and the 'net result is a whole lot of miscommunication, severed relationships, and caught feelings all around. The GB's find this very entertaining and have thus created an award dedicated to the sensitive artist on the web, the Most Defensive Award.

The inaugural Mos Deffy goes to Questlove of The Roots and Okayplayer. The Roots' drummer has a long history of being the starting catcher for the All Feelings Team, hyperly defending everything from Phrenology, to crossover attempts, to his love for Northern State. Nevermind that most of the people on the Okayplayer boards are suckups who would willingly accept a 26 minute psychedelic instrumental Roots jam in the ass if that's what he wanted to put out. No, it's the critical fans that get his 'fro wound up.

So, he finally decided that the four people on there who had critical opinions and dared to post them were just too much for him to bear. He employed a famous message board tactic, and all-time favorite of the GB's, the Farewell Post. When asked if he wouldn't be posting anymore, Brother Questionmark Asylum responded in the affirmative:

This is what it looks like when Questdove cries. An unfortunate result of this is that resident Okayhater fwmj has also dropped his own Farewell Post. Citing irreconcilable differences with the okay's, your boy said it best:

there is absolutely no logical reason for a grown man, 10 years my senior, to leave his own website because of a few people (and apparently, namely me since y'all keep tryin to make me famous) with unrelenting opinions about his most recent work, some of his more questionable business moves, backdoor hating on his ex-co-conspiritors, peers, and contemporaries, and backpeddling on previously held and quite sound ideals.

i don't come here now and didn't come here in '99 to ham it up with ?uest. being starstruck is not me. i came here to talk about music from time to time with folks i might grow to respect. but i realise there are many more people, mostly johnny-come-lately Roots fans (or johnny-come-lately rap fans in general), that are here to ham it up with ?uest/kiss ?uest and Co's ass than there are of me.

Now, we all know how the Farewell Post goes. A poster vows never to post again, only to lurk for a period before finally giving in and posting. They always come back. Although, there does seem to be something different about this particular case. The departure of fwmj leaves the Okayplayer boards in even worse shape than before, if you can imagine such a thing. fwmj is needed there, now more than ever. If he is serious about jetting, he will find that he is welcome here at the GB.

Big ups to Questlove for taking home the first Mos Deffy. You can put it next to your Grammy.
